2025上合组织国家电影节在重庆闭幕
Zhong Guo Xin Wen Wang· 2025-07-06 16:14
Core Points - The 2025 Shanghai Cooperation Organization (SCO) Film Festival concluded on July 6 in Yongchuan, Chongqing, with Chinese film "The Third Squad" and Russian film "Air Combat" winning the "Golden Camellia Award" for Best Film [1][3] - This film festival is a significant cultural exchange event held in conjunction with the SCO summit, marking its return to China after seven years [1][3] Awards Summary - The festival featured a total of 10 awards, with notable winners including: - Best Actor: Bakhtiyar Khadzhibaev from Kazakhstan's film "Alarm Action" [3] - Best Actress: Lano Shokhieva from Uzbekistan's film "Chasing Spring" [3] - Best Director: Baatar Uulger from Mongolia's film "Father" [3] - Best Screenplay: Kyrgyzstan's film "Border Trade" [3] - Best Editing: Pakistan's film "Termite" [3] - Best Cinematography: Mongolia's film "Golden Horizon" [3] - Best Music: China's film "Bazaar Joy" [3] - Best Art Design: Belarus's film "Black Castle" [3] - Special Jury Awards: Tajikistan's "Seeking Truth," Pakistan's "Nayab," and Iran's "The Last Whale Shark" [3] Event Highlights - The festival was co-hosted by the National Film Administration of China and the Chongqing Municipal Government, themed "Technology Light and Shadow, SCO Style" [3] - Key activities included a film market, film cooperation forum, technology achievements exhibition, SCO Night film-themed concert, and outdoor market, showcasing 28 films from 10 countries [3]
